Dell EMC DES-5121 Exam Syllabus Topics:
| Topic | Details | Weights |
|---|---|---|
| Networking Overview | - Explain the typical end-to-end data flow of a Campus network - Identify and describe the common Campus networking topologies - Identify and describe the steps required to configure multicasting into an existing multicast environment | 8% |
| Protocols: Spanning Tree (STP) and Virtual Router Redundancy (VRRP) | - Describe how RSTP, MSTP, and RSTP-PV are configured and validated - Describe how to configure PortFast, FastLink, and STP protection - Identify and describe VRRP components and their basic operations - Describe VRRP priorities including contrast and compare preemption versus no preemption | 15% |
| Security: Port Security and Authentication, Authorization, Accounting (AAA) Security | - Compare and contrast the various port security methods and identify ports with port security enabled - Describe how to configure sticky MAC addresses and configure a switch to point to a RADIUS server - Describe the purpose of AAA security; configure local authentication and AAA security | 14% |
| VoIP and Quality of Service (QoS) | - Identify and describe the process in which an IP phone obtains its configuration and the cause for an IP phone not powering on - Identify and describe the configuration requirements to support VoIP devices - Describe QoS basic operations, operational characteristics, and how QoS identifies and marks traffic - Describe how to configure QoS on Dell EMC N-Series switches | 15% |
| Routing: VLANs and Policy-Based Routing (PBR) | - Identify and describe VLAN routing and private VLANs including their use in a Campus network environment -Explain how to determine a port VLAN membership and configure port trunking - Describe policy-based routing (PBR) basic operations -Explain how to configure and validate policy-based routing (PBR) configurations | 15% |
| Switch Configuration | - Describe the differences between the initial setup requirements for a standalone switch versus a stack of switches -Explain how to configure a Dell EMC N-Series switch including boot sequence, applying a management IP address, switch name, and credentials - Identify and the describe the steps to upgrade switch firmware | 11% |
| Power over Ethernet (PoE) | - Describe the purpose for PoE, its benefits, and common PoE devices - Describe how to configure PoE on a switch port and measure power output | 6% |
| Security: Access Control Lists (ACLs) | - Identify and describe the various commands used to either deny or permit IP connectivity -Describe the configuration steps to permit host access control; identify and troubleshoot server access issues | 8% |
| Link Aggregation Group (LAG) and Multi-Chassis Link Aggregation Group (MLAG) | - Describe how to configure a static and a dynamic LAG - Explain how to troubleshoot LAG configuration mismatches - Describe how to configure and validate MLAG configurations and how to upgrade switch firmware in an MLAG configuration | 11% |
